文章目錄
- 前言
- 0 什么是StarRcoks?
- 1. 關于 SRCA 考試
- 2. 備考資料與學習方式
- 2.1 官方文檔與教程
- 2.2 在線培訓課程
- 2.3 實戰演練
- 3. 重點考試內容
- 3.1 StarRocks 架構與原理
- 3.2 數據導入與導出
- 3.3 SQL 查詢優化
- 3.4 性能調優
- 4. 備考建議
- 4.1 多做實操
- 4.2 注重考試中的細節
- 4.3 知識點的重點突破
- 5. 考試經驗
- 6. 考試入口
- 6. 本人經驗分享
- 7.證書展示
- 8. 總結
StarRocks SRCA 考試心得總結

前言
最近我有幸參加了 StarRocks SRCA(StarRocks Certified Associate) 考試,這次考試不僅讓我深入理解了 StarRocks 的核心概念,還提升了我對其在大數據場景下應用的理解。在這里,我想與大家分享我的考試心得,幫助準備 SRCA 考試的朋友們能更加高效地備考。
0 什么是StarRcoks?
StarRocks 是一款高性能分析型數據倉庫,使用向量化、MPP 架構、CBO、智能物化視圖、可實時更新的列式存儲引擎等技術實現多維、實時、高并發的數據分析。StarRocks 既支持從各類實時和離線的數據源高效導入數據,也支持直接分析數據湖上各種格式的數據。StarRocks 兼容 MySQL 協議,可使用 MySQL 客戶端和常用 BI 工具對接。同時 StarRocks 具備水平擴展,高可用、高可靠、易運維等特性。廣泛應用于實時數倉、OLAP 報表、數據湖分析等場景。
StarRocks 是 Linux 基金會項目,采用 Apache 2.0 許可證,可在 StarRocks GitHub 存儲庫中找到(請參閱 StarRocks 許可證)。StarRocks(i)鏈接或調用第三方軟件庫中的函數,其許可證可在 licenses-binary 文件夾中找到;和(ii)包含第三方軟件代碼,其許可證可在 licenses 文件夾中找到。
這些公司都在用他
1. 關于 SRCA 考試
SRCA 是 StarRocks 官方認證考試,旨在驗證考生是否掌握了 StarRocks 的基本操作與管理能力。通過該認證可以證明你具備使用 StarRocks 進行大規模數據分析和性能優化的基本能力。考試內容主要涵蓋以下幾個方面:
- StarRocks 的架構與組件
- 常見數據庫操作與優化技巧----重點學習
- 性能調優與查詢優化
- StarRocks 安裝與配置
- 數據導入導出----重點學習
- 監控與維護----重點學習
2. 備考資料與學習方式
在備考期間,我主要通過以下幾種方式進行學習:
2.1 官方文檔與教程
StarRocks 的官方文檔是學習的核心資源,其中詳細介紹了數據庫架構、安裝配置、查詢優化等內容。建議考生在學習過程中多翻閱文檔,特別是關于性能調優和數據導入導出的部分。StarRocks 文檔的結構清晰,涵蓋了從基礎到高級的內容,是備考必不可少的參考資料。
幫助文檔 https://docs.starrocks.io/zh/docs/introduction/StarRocks_intro/
2.2 在線培訓課程
除了官方文檔,參加一些在線培訓課程也是非常有效的學習方式。這些課程一般會有專門的講師帶領,通過實際操作演示來幫助大家更好地理解技術概念。在課程中,講師不僅會講解理論知識,還會提供實際的解決方案和案例分析,幫助考生將理論知識轉化為實踐能力。
-
官方課程
-
B站在線培訓課程
2.3 實戰演練
通過設置個人的測試環境,進行 StarRocks 的實際操作,也是備考中的關鍵部分。在安裝與配置方面,我動手搭建了 StarRocks 集群,并嘗試了多種數據導入導出的方式,熟悉了常見的 SQL 查詢優化技巧和性能調優手段。通過這些操作,我能夠更直觀地理解 StarRocks 的工作原理。
3. 重點考試內容
考試的內容廣泛,以下是我認為需要重點掌握的幾個方面:
3.1 StarRocks 架構與原理
StarRocks 是一款高性能的分布式數據庫,理解其架構和各個組件的作用是考試中的重中之重。特別是要理解其計算與存儲引擎的交互,分布式計算的優勢,以及如何利用其架構實現大規模數據的高效分析。
3.2 數據導入與導出
數據導入導出是 StarRocks 中非常重要的一部分,考試中會涉及到如何使用 LOAD
語句進行大數據量的導入、如何進行實時數據流的處理以及如何高效地導出數據。我建議深入理解每種導入方式的適用場景,以及如何根據實際情況進行選擇。
3.3 SQL 查詢優化
考試中會有大量與 SQL 查詢優化相關的問題,包括如何使用索引、如何合理設計表結構、如何優化復雜查詢等。掌握如何解讀查詢執行計劃,分析其瓶頸,并通過調整索引、優化 SQL 語句來提升查詢性能,是通過考試的關鍵。
3.4 性能調優
StarRocks 提供了許多性能調優的功能,比如集群配置、數據分區、緩存機制等。在備考過程中,重點了解如何通過合理的表設計、合理選擇分區方式、調整集群參數等方式來優化系統的性能是非常必要的。
4. 備考建議
4.1 多做實操
理論知識固然重要,但真正的技術能力來自于實踐。在備考過程中,建議通過實際操作加深對知識點的理解。可以嘗試在本地環境搭建 StarRocks 集群,并進行常見操作,比如數據導入、性能優化、查詢調優等。
4.2 注重考試中的細節
在考試過程中,細節往往決定成敗。特別是一些命令參數、SQL 語句的書寫規范等,考生在答題時要小心謹慎,確保理解每個問題的細節,避免因粗心而喪失得分機會。
4.3 知識點的重點突破
通過考試大綱和模擬題,明確考試的重點和難點。在備考過程中,可以通過做題來檢驗自己對知識點的掌握情況。通過總結錯誤的題目,不斷調整學習策略,逐步提高自己的技術水平。
5. 考試經驗
在考試時,建議先快速瀏覽一遍所有題目,標記出自己能夠快速回答的問題。這樣可以節省時間,留給難題更多的思考時間。如果遇到難題,可以先跳過,等做完其他部分后再回來看。
考試采用線上考試 (需要開攝像頭)
6. 考試入口
考試入口
6. 本人經驗分享
-
由于之前公司一直在用starrocks 所以的學習周期有所縮短。但是也要有效復習40小時以上。,如果是初學者建議 80小時以上
-
題庫相對穩定 (官方文檔在線培訓課程 (推薦)一定要考看,每個視屏都有課后練習
課程鏈接 https://www.mirrorship.cn/zh-CN/training/course/SRCA
課程模擬答案 https://forum.mirrorship.cn/t/topic/14628 -
考試費用 600 元
-
考試概覽和大綱
5.考試概覽和大綱 (重點關注 02,03,05 章節 抓分項)
7.證書展示
本人在 2025年04月12日通過考試 。
8. 總結
SRCA 考試是一次很好的學習與提升的機會,不僅能夠幫助考生鞏固 StarRocks 的核心知識,也能提高我們在大數據處理、數據庫優化等方面的實際能力。通過此次考試,我對 StarRocks 的使用和優化有了更加深入的理解,也為我今后的職業生涯提供了更多的信心和動力。
如果你也正在準備 SRCA 考試,希望我的心得對你有所幫助。祝愿你順利通過考試,成為一名合格的 StarRocks 專家!